Overview

Co-hosted by CalCPA President & CEO Denise LeDuc Froemming and CalCPA Health CEO Ron Lang, CalCPA’s Workplace Wellness Series offer actionable strategies to support employee wellbeing, and are free to members. Explore how intentional sacrifice, smart prioritization, and realistic expectations can help you grow personally and professionally. This session provides tools like the Eisenhower Matrix and MoSCoW Method to help you focus on what truly matters and make choices that align with your long-term goals. Learn to navigate fear, protect your well-being, and build a support system that keeps you grounded while pursuing what’s most important.
